An investigation has been launched after a report of a sexual assault last night.

A woman was grabbed and assaulted by an unknown man in Bewbush Drive, Crawley, Sussex Police say.

The force believe the attack was an isolated incident and officers are now carrying out house-to-house enquiries as they seek to identify the person responsible.

The woman was grabbed at about 8.15pm, but was able to break free and run to a place of safety. The incident was then reported to police.

Chief Inspector Shane Baker said: "Our teams will be carrying out fast-time actions including house-to-house enquiries as we work to identify the suspect responsible.

"We are treating this an isolated incident, however we will be carrying out additional patrols to provide reassurance to the local community."
